Latest Patents
One of Seay's latest inventions is the "Magnetic Pay Telephone Cash Box Proximity Switch." This innovative device is designed for public telephones and is strategically mounted within the upper portion of a lower housing, situated above the vault area. The switch is encased in a sealed housing, effectively safeguarding it from contamination caused by dirt, moisture, and other environmental elements. A magnet is cleverly utilized to create a bi-stable magnetic circuit that links the floor of the lower phone housing to the cash box lid within the vault area.
